Understanding AI-Powered Cost Forecasting in Azure

AI-powered cost forecasting in Azure involves utilizing machine learning algorithms to predict future cloud expenditures based on historical usage patterns, service demands, and other variables. Azure provides several tools to facilitate this:

  • Azure Cost Management + Billing: This suite offers features like cost analysis, budgeting, and forecasting. By analyzing past spending trends, it can predict future costs, helping organizations plan their budgets effectively.

  • Azure Advisor: A personalized cloud consultant that provides best practices and recommendations to optimize Azure deployments. It offers insights into cost-saving opportunities, such as resizing or shutting down underutilized resources.

  • Azure Machine Learning: For advanced users, Azure Machine Learning can be employed to build custom models that predict cloud costs based on specific business metrics and usage patterns.

Implementing AI-driven forecasting allows organizations to anticipate cost spikes, identify inefficiencies, and make informed decisions to stay within budget.

 

The Role of AI in Resource Allocation

Efficient resource allocation ensures that cloud resources are utilized optimally, preventing both over-provisioning and under-provisioning. AI plays a crucial role in this by:

  • Predictive Scaling: AI algorithms analyze usage patterns to predict demand surges, enabling automatic scaling of resources to meet these demands without manual intervention.

  • Rightsizing Recommendations: Tools like Azure Advisor provide AI-driven suggestions to resize resources based on actual usage, ensuring that organizations only pay for what they need.

  • Anomaly Detection: AI can identify unusual usage patterns or potential misconfigurations that could lead to unnecessary costs, allowing for proactive adjustments.

By integrating AI into resource allocation strategies, organizations can achieve a balance between performance and cost-efficiency.
